Zanzibar

Just off the coast of Tanzania lies an entrancing archipelago known as Zanzibar. This gorgeous string of islands is the land of sultans, palaces beaches and spice-filled markets. Once an important trading center, many restorations have been done in recent years to restore Zanzibar to its ancient grandeur - earning its capital city UNESCO World Heritage status in 2000.

Sao Paulo

With a population of around 11 million, and 20 million in the metropolitan area, Sao Paulo is the largest city in Brazil. It's also one of the wealthiest cities in the southern hemisphere, although you don't have to look far to see the income disparities and inequalities that exist. The city is diverse and culturally rich, with excellent food, music, and entertainment.

Which place is cheaper, Sao Paulo or Zanzibar?

These are the overall average travel costs for the two destinations. These travel costs come from the actual spending of real travelers.

The average daily cost (per person) in Zanzibar is $66, while the average daily cost in Sao Paulo is $60.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ination. When is the best time to visit Zanzibar or Sao Paulo?

Sao Paulo has a temperate climate with four distinct seasons, but Zanzibar experiences a warm climate with fairly sunny weather most of the year.

Typical Weather for Sao Paulo and Zanzibar

Zanzibar Sao Paulo
Temp (°C) Rain (mm) Temp (°C) Rain (mm)
Jan 28°C (82°F) 78 mm (3.1 in) 25°C (77°F) 170 mm (6.7 in)
Feb 28°C (82°F) 52 mm (2 in) 25°C (77°F) 170 mm (6.7 in)
Mar 28°C (83°F) 131 mm (5.2 in) 24°C (75°F) 120 mm (4.7 in)
Apr 27°C (81°F) 269 mm (10.6 in) 22°C (72°F) 50 mm (2 in)
May 26°C (78°F) 176 mm (6.9 in) 21°C (70°F) 30 mm (1.2 in)
Jun 24°C (76°F) 42 mm (1.7 in) 19°C (66°F) 20 mm (0.8 in)
Jul 25°C (77°F) 31 mm (1.2 in) 19°C (66°F) 20 mm (0.8 in)
Aug 24°C (75°F) 27 mm (1.1 in) 19°C (66°F) 10 mm (0.4 in)
Sep 25°C (76°F) 28 mm (1.1 in) 21°C (70°F) 60 mm (2.4 in)
Oct 25°C (78°F) 66 mm (2.6 in) 21°C (70°F) 90 mm (3.5 in)
Nov 27°C (80°F) 132 mm (5.2 in) 23°C (73°F) 110 mm (4.3 in)
Dec 27°C (81°F) 116 mm (4.6 in) 24°C (75°F) 150 mm (5.9 in)
